TI's J7200 for which the QSGMII main port property is fetched from the device-tree has only one QSGMII main port. However, devices like TI's J721e support up to two QSGMII main ports. Thus, the existing methods for fetching and using the QSGMII main port are not scalable. Update the existing methods for handling the QSGMII main ports and its associated requirements to make it scalable for future devices.
